China-linked threat actor Red Heron exploited CVE-2026-60004, a critical remote-code-execution vulnerability in Gitea, to compromise 13 organizations in Canada, Argentina, Taiwan, the United States, Qatar, and Sri Lanka. After the flaw’s public disclosure, the operator scanned 1,386 Gitea servers across seven countries and separately tracked 477 systems in Taiwan, targeting organizations in defense, elections, energy, aerospace, telecommunications, government, public safety, and research.
Red Heron integrated public proof-of-concept code into a Python automation framework that created accounts, exploited exposed servers, exfiltrated repositories, and selectively removed evidence. The intrusions stole source code, credentials, secrets, tokens, SSH keys, and internal applications; in one Taiwanese victim, the actor moved laterally to root-level access across a three-node Proxmox cluster. The group maintained access with the JITTERLY Linux implant and its embedded SIXZUT LD_PRELOAD rootkit, enabling covert persistence, post-exploitation activity, and evasion.

Red Heron began using the Python framework exp_enhanced.py, which automated account registration, exploitation of vulnerable Gitea servers, repository theft, and selected trace removal.
CVE-2026-60004, a critical remote-code-execution vulnerability affecting Gitea, was disclosed in July 2026.
In a Taiwanese victim environment, Red Heron pivoted from a compromised Gitea server to root-level administrative access across a three-node Proxmox cluster.
Red Heron deployed the C++ Linux implant JITTERLY, which supports more than 30 post-exploitation capabilities and contains the undocumented SIXZUT LD_PRELOAD rootkit for hiding files, processes, and network connections and resisting removal.
The actor exfiltrated source repositories and sensitive materials including configuration secrets, internal tokens, SSH keys, and internal applications from victims including Taiwanese industrial automation, Qatari, and Canadian renewable-energy organizations.
Red Heron's Gitea campaign compromised two organizations in Canada; one each in Argentina, Qatar, and Sri Lanka; and four each in Taiwan and the United States. Targeted sectors included defense, elections, energy, aerospace, telecommunications, government, public safety, and research.
The actor scanned 1,386 internet-facing Gitea instances across seven countries and maintained a separate dataset covering 477 systems in Taiwan.
Before adopting the Gitea exploit, Red Heron used the same infrastructure and a Python script named exp.py to target 18 Joomla websites, including an India-based education consulting firm and a U.S.-based managed service provider.
